with Expertsystem;
use Expertsystem;
package body Sticker is
type Sticker_Structure is
record
Color : Colors;
State : States;
end record;
package Behavior is new Classbehavior (Sticker_Structure, "STICKERS ");
------------------------------------------------------------------------------
function Color (O : Object) return Colors is
begin
return Behavior.Get (O).Color;
end Color;
function State (O : Object) return States is
begin
return Behavior.Get (O).State;
end State;
------------------------------------------------------------------------------
function Instances (Kind : Existences := All_Stickers)
return Collection.Object is
Co : Collection.Object;
function White_Sticker_Predicate (O : Object) return Boolean is
begin
return Behavior.Get (O).Color = White;
end White_Sticker_Predicate;
function White_Stickers is
new Collection.Restrict (White_Sticker_Predicate);
function Red_Sticker_Predicate (O : Object) return Boolean is
begin
return Behavior.Get (O).Color = Red;
end Red_Sticker_Predicate;
function Red_Stickers is
new Collection.Restrict (Red_Sticker_Predicate);
function Unused_Predicate (O : Object) return Boolean is
begin
return Behavior.Get (O).State = Is_Unused;
end Unused_Predicate;
function Unused is new Collection.Restrict (Unused_Predicate);
begin
case Kind is
when All_Stickers =>
return Behavior.Instances;
when Unused_Stickers =>
return Unused (Behavior.Instances);
when White_Stickers =>
return White_Stickers (Behavior.Instances);
when Red_Stickers =>
return Red_Stickers (Behavior.Instances);
when others =>
return Behavior.Instances;
end case;
return Co;
end Instances;
------------------------------------------------------------------------------
function Exist (With_Color : String; In_Kind_Of_Collection : Existences)
return Boolean is
function Is_Color (O : Object) return Boolean is
begin
return Colors'Image (Behavior.Get (O).Color) = With_Color;
end Is_Color;
function Exist_Color is new Collection.Exist (Is_Color);
begin
return Exist_Color (Instances (Kind => In_Kind_Of_Collection));
end Exist;
function Exist (With_State : States; In_Kind_Of_Collection : Existences)
return Boolean is
function Is_State (O : Object) return Boolean is
begin
return Behavior.Get (O).State = With_State;
end Is_State;
function Exist_State is new Collection.Exist (Is_State);
begin
return Exist_State (Instances (Kind => In_Kind_Of_Collection));
end Exist;
------------------------------------------------------------------------------
function Add (With_Color : Colors := Default_Color;
With_State : States := Default_State) return Object is
A_Sticker : Sticker_Structure;
begin
A_Sticker.Color := With_Color;
A_Sticker.State := With_State;
return Behavior.Allocate (Initvalue => A_Sticker);
end Add;
------------------------------------------------------------------------------
procedure Change (O : Object; With_Color : Colors; With_State : States) is
A_Sticker : Sticker_Structure;
begin
A_Sticker := Behavior.Get (Aref => O);
A_Sticker.Color := With_Color;
A_Sticker.State := With_State;
Behavior.Set (Aref => O, Withvalue => A_Sticker);
end Change;
procedure Change (O : Object; With_State : States) is
A_Sticker : Sticker_Structure;
begin
A_Sticker := Behavior.Get (Aref => O);
A_Sticker.State := With_State;
Behavior.Set (Aref => O, Withvalue => A_Sticker);
end Change;
------------------------------------------------------------------------------
procedure Delete (O : Object) is
begin
Behavior.Dispose (Aref => O);
end Delete;
------------------------------------------------------------------------------
procedure Clean is
begin
Behavior.Clear;
end Clean;
end Sticker;
